Job Description:

Governance and Analytics is a centralized group within Operational Risk and Control group that provide risk analysis, reporting, governance, communication and risk initiative support across the home lending organization.  The Quality Analyst III will be part of the Governance and Analytics group, responsible for managing and supporting various projects that require Operational Risk oversight.  In this role, the individual will work closely with various lines of business and project managers to appropriately identify risk issues and ensure that appropriate action plans are developed and tracked.  This function requires a detail oriented individual who is able to execute well in a fast paced environment while working on multiple, concurrent projects.

 

 

Responsibilities

 


  • Provide support for key initiatives with a focus on projects monitored by Operational Risk Management and Compliance across the Home Lending organization.

  • Develop risk issues into action plans including working with various business units, project managers, Legal, and Compliance to ensure that action plans are addressed in a timely and sufficient manner.

  • Work closely with Operational Risk Management and each line of business ensuring that issues, root cause, and action plans are appropriately identified, defined, analyzed, and reported.

  • Establish and maintain strong working relationships with project managers and key members of the line of business through ongoing coordination of operational matters and utilizing effective communication and, when warranted, conflict and resolution skills.

  • Coordinates with Corporate Operational Risk Management regarding corporate risk reporting.

  • Ensures action plans are comprehensive and completed in a timely and accurate manner with appropriate validation.

  • Work with validation teams and Compliance to ensure action plan task steps are complete and effective.

  • Identify the severity of the risks, notify the appropriate business areas of the risk and continue follow up with the appropriate business areas until the risks are resolved.


 

 

  • Experience with identifying risks and developing mitigating controls

  • Understanding of project management beneficial

  • Knowledge of Work Request Management (WRM) System and Project Health Status (PHS) System beneficial

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ills; Excellent organizational and time management skills

  • Strong analytical skills including the ability to probe sensitive issues while maintaining the highest level of integrity and objectivity

  • Ability to perform multiple tasks in a fluid environment with varying levels of complexity, importance and involvement

  • Excellent Microsoft Office (Excel, PowerPoint, Word and Access) skills

  • Home Loan Default background, along with working knowledge of Collections & Default policy and procedures beneficial

  • Working knowledge of Home Loan servicing systems beneficial
